The iPhone 14 series is expected to be in high demand in China. A survey by trusted Apple analyst Ming-Chi Kuo claims that suppliers and retailers pay significantly higher deposits to prepay for the first expected units of the iPhone 14. In some areas, the deposit is said to be double the amount. The analyst shared this in a series of tweets.
The iPhone 14 series is expected to launch in September this year, but two months ago, the demand for it will be higher than the previous generation iPhone 13. Apple’s new generation iPhone 14 series has also been the subject of many sources and rumors. China is also an important market for Apple, with the country accounting for one-fifth of the company’s total revenue.
Kuo says the expected increase in demand for the iPhone 14 is to ensure adequate supply. The analyst adds that the iPhone 14 supply forecast from component suppliers and EMS is around 100 million 90 million units in the second half of 2022. The stable demand is likely to reduce the risk of reduced orders after the launch of the iPhone 14.
